Poria / Hoelen Spirit (Wolfiporia Extensa)

Hoelen Spirit, commonly known as Poria Cocos or Chinese Tuckahoe, is a medicinal mushroom that has been used in traditional Chinese medicine for centuries. This mushroom belongs to the Polyporaceae family and is native to various parts of Asia, including China, Japan, and Korea. Hoelen Spirit is known for its potential health benefits and has been incorporated into herbal remedies for its purported medicinal properties.

One of the primary traditional uses of Hoelen Spirit is for its diuretic and anti-edema properties. It is believed to help alleviate water retention and promote urination, making it a valuable component in formulas aimed at treating conditions like edema and bloating.

In traditional Chinese medicine, Hoelen Spirit is also used to support the digestive system. It is believed to help strengthen the spleen and alleviate symptoms of indigestion, such as diarrhoea and abdominal discomfort. This mushroom is often included in herbal formulas designed to improve gastrointestinal health and balance.

Hoelen Spirit contains bioactive compounds such as triterpenes, polysaccharides, and beta-glucans, which have sparked interest in its potential immune-boosting and anti-inflammatory properties. While more research is needed to fully understand its mechanisms of action, preliminary studies suggest that these compounds may have an impact on the immune system and inflammation regulation.
